>>> I've written a move animation using the gwt way (extending animation 
>>> class etc.) and it works great but I've noticed that when that if I keep 
>>> the duration the same say 1000ms the longer the move distance is the 
>>> choppier the animation seems (the animation is smoother the shorter the 
>>> move distance is). I figured that this is because of the frame rate. In the 
>>> doc the frame rate is stated to be "non-fixed". 
>>>
>>> Does anyone know if it is possible to increase the frame rate on the 
>>> animation
>>
>>
>> No, it's not possible.
>>  
>>
>>> and if not can anyone suggest or have an idea on how to make the 
>>> animation smoother?
>>>
>>
>> Which browser were you testing this in? In Firefox and Chrome it should 
>> use requestAnimationFrame whose role is to defer to the browser the choice 
>> of the frame rate so that it stays responsive 
>> See https://developer.mozilla.org/en/DOM/window.requestAnimationFrame
>>  and 
>> http://code.google.com/p/google-web-toolkit/source/browse/trunk/user/src/com/google/gwt/animation/Animation.gwt.xml
>> (and 
>> http://code.google.com/p/google-web-toolkit/source/browse/trunk/user/src/com/google/gwt/animation/client/AnimationSchedulerImplTimer.java
>>  which 
>> uses a timer that tries to achieve 60Hz frame rate)
>>
>> If your animation is not smooth, it's probably that it doesn't run at 
>> approx. 60Hz, which means that either your code in the animation or some 
>> other code runs too slowly to achieve that rate. Because timers and 
>> requestAnimationFrame (and basically everything in a browser) go through 
>> the event loop and task queues <
>> http://www.whatwg.org/specs/web-apps/current-work/multipage/webappapis.html#event-loops>
>>  
>> it can be that something else than the animation is pushing too many tasks 
>> in the queue and/or that those task run slowly, delaying other tasks and 
>> therefore prevent reaching the 60Hz target rate.
>>
>> Oh, of course, it can also be that you're trying to do the impossible, 
> and the only solution would be to run the animation for a longer duration 
> so that the moves between each frame (at the same frame rate) are smaller.
